Civil Rights Legal Terms You Should Know

Familiarizing yourself with important terminology can help in understanding your case and the legal process. Here are some key terms commonly encountered in civil rights law.

Discrimination

Discrimination refers to unfair or unequal treatment of individuals based on characteristics such as race, gender, age, disability, or sexual orientation. It is prohibited under various federal and state laws to ensure equal opportunity and protection for all.

Retaliation

Retaliation occurs when an employer or entity punishes an individual for asserting their rights, such as filing a complaint about discrimination or participating in an investigation. Laws protect against such adverse actions to encourage the reporting of unlawful conduct.

False Arrest

False arrest involves the unlawful detention of an individual without proper legal authority or justification. Victims of false arrest may seek compensation and other legal remedies to address the violation of their rights.

Whistleblower Claims

Whistleblower claims arise when employees report illegal or unethical conduct within an organization and face retaliation as a result. Laws protect whistleblowers to promote accountability and transparency in the workplace.

If you experience workplace discrimination, it is important to document all relevant incidents, including dates, descriptions, and any communications. You should also report the behavior through your employer’s internal procedures if available. Seeking legal advice can help determine whether your situation qualifies for a discrimination claim under laws such as the NYS Human Rights Law or federal statutes. Legal counsel can assist in filing complaints with agencies like the EEOC or negotiating resolutions. Acting promptly helps preserve your rights and strengthens your case.

Compensation in civil rights cases may include monetary damages for physical or emotional harm, lost wages, and punitive damages aimed at deterring future misconduct. The amount depends on the specifics of the case, including the severity of the violation and its impact on the individual. Legal counsel can help evaluate potential recovery and negotiate settlements or pursue court awards. It is important to understand that each case is unique, and compensation varies accordingly.

The timeline for resolving a civil rights claim varies widely depending on factors such as case complexity, the parties involved, and the chosen legal approach. Some claims may be resolved through administrative processes in a matter of months, while others requiring litigation can take years. Legal counsel can provide an estimated timeline based on your case details and keep you informed about progress. Patience and persistence are often necessary when pursuing civil rights claims.
